The function __scsi_remove_target iterates through the SCSI devices on
the host, but it drops the host_lock before calling
scsi_remove_device. When the SCSI device is deleted from another
thread, the pointer to the SCSI device in scsi_remove_device can
become invalid. Fix this by getting a reference to the SCSI device
before dropping the host_lock to keep the SCSI device alive for the
call to scsi_remove_device.

commit f63ae56e4e97fb12053590e41a4fa59e7daa74a4 upstream.

gdth_ioctl_alloc() takes the size variable as an int.
copy_from_user() takes the size variable as an unsigned long.
gen.data_len and gen.sense_len are unsigned longs.
On x86_64 longs are 64 bit and ints are 32 bit.

We could pass in a very large number and the allocation would truncate
the size to 32 bits and allocate a small buffer.  Then when we do the
copy_from_user(), it would result in a memory corruption.

commit f0ad30d3d2dc924decc0e10b1ff6dc32525a5d99 upstream.

Some cards (like mvsas) have issue troubles if non-NCQ commands are
mixed with NCQ ones.  Fix this by using the libata default NCQ check
routine which waits until all NCQ commands are complete before issuing
a non-NCQ one.  The impact to cards (like aic94xx) which don't need
this logic should be minimal

commit 3bcf8229a8c49769e48d3e0bd1e20d8e003f8106 upstream.

As reported in &lt;https://bugzilla.kernel.org/show_bug.cgi?id=15355&gt;, r6040_
multicast_list currently crashes. This is due a wrong maximum of multicast
entries. This patch fixes the following issues with multicast:

- number of maximum entries if off-by-one (4 instead of 3)

- the writing of the hash table index is not necessary and leads to invalid
values being written into the MCR1 register, so the MAC is simply put in a non
coherent state

- when we exceed the maximum number of mutlticast address, writing the
broadcast address should be done in registers MID_1{L,M,H} instead of
MID_O{L,M,H}, otherwise we would loose the adapter's MAC address

commit ec5a32f67c603b11d68eb283d94eb89a4f6cfce1 upstream.

adapter-&gt;cmb.cmb is initialized when the device is opened and freed when
it's closed. Accessing it unconditionally during resume results either
in a crash (NULL pointer dereference, when the interface has not been
opened yet) or data corruption (when the interface has been used and
brought down adapter-&gt;cmb.cmb points to a deallocated memory area).

commit cc60f8878eab892c03d06b10f389232b9b66bd83 upstream.

When using simultaneously the two DMA channels on a same engine, some
transfers are never completed. For example, an endless lock can occur
while writing heavily on a RAID5 array (with async-tx offload support
enabled).

Note that this issue can also be reproduced by using the DMA test
client.

On a same engine, the interrupt cause register is shared between two
DMA channels. This patch make sure that the cause bit is only cleared
for the requested channel.

commit 3e645d6b485446c54c6745c5e2cf5c528fe4deec upstream.

The compat code for the VIDIOCSMICROCODE ioctl is totally buggered.
It's only used by the VIDEO_STRADIS driver, and that one is scheduled to
staging and eventually removed unless somebody steps up to maintain it
(at which point it should use request_firmware() rather than some magic
ioctl).  So we'll get rid of it eventually.

But in the meantime, the compatibility ioctl code is broken, and this
tries to get it to at least limp along (even if Mauro suggested just
deleting it entirely, which may be the right thing to do - I don't think
the compatibility translation code has ever worked unless you were very
lucky).
